Colmans Seafood Temple launches delivery service and fans could not be more excited

One of the North East's favourite chippies is reopening its restaurant for takeways next week.

The award-winning Colmans in South Shields, which is famed for its fish and chips, is now inviting customers to place orders at its restaurant for fishy favourites and even tipples from the bar.

Colmans Seafood Temple - a fish and chip restaurant which also has a cocktail and oyster bar - is to reopen from Monday when available slots will go live - via its new online click and collect and home delivery service - for orders later in the week.

On offer will be traditional classics and the most popular restaurant dishes as well as a selection of bar drinks.

Customers will be able to preorder from Monday for the service which will run between noon and 7.30pm from Friday to Sunday and one eager fan wrote on its Facebook page: "Counting down the days for the curry!"

All orders for restaurant dishes must be placed online although it will be taking orders from a limited menu for 'walk-ins' going to the restaurant's side hatch.

Colmans' sister venue, the original takeaway in Ocean Road, also invites walk-in orders and offers click and collect but will not be doing deliveries.

The local company has netted lots of awards over the years including Colmans Seafood Temple being named as one of the UK's top 10 best fish and chip restaurants in the Fry Magazine awards and the takeaway picked as one of the UK’s top 50 best fish and chip takeaways.

It also has been included in the Good Food Guide and The Times newspaper’s 30 Best Fish and Chip Shops in the UK, and been picked as BBC’s Countryfile magazine’s best UK Fish and Chip Shop.
